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2053976 3786364 5092801311 0170463
02424031 83798163 22595385376
02424031 83798163 22595385376
54 583310 75 87815822827
All about undefined
Interested in learning more?
02424031 83798163 22595385376
54 583310 75 87815822827
See more
7881772059 11629009 812
33138165 9088658191 72376
See more
93996009213 750208
865413806 3834025236 14813370933
See more